7
ответов

Что такое проблема выбора & ldquo; N + 1? Rdquo; в ORM (объектно-реляционное отображение)?

«Проблема выбора N + 1» обычно указывается как проблема в обсуждениях объектно-реляционного отображения (ORM), и я понимаю, что это как-то связано с необходимостью выполнять множество запросов к базе данных ...
вопрос задан: 26 February 2019 08:41
1
ответ

Выберите n+1 проблему

У Foo есть Заголовок. Ссылки панели Foo. У меня есть набор с Панелями. Мне нужен набор с Foo. Заголовок. Если у меня будет 10 панелей в наборе, то я назову дб 10 раз. панели. Выберите (x => x. Foo. Заголовок) В...
вопрос задан: 23 May 2017 12:07
0
ответов

Как избежать NHibernate N + 1 с составным ключом

РЕДАКТИРОВАТЬ Я переделал весь проект для решения этой проблемы. Итак, я переделал вопрос. Я хочу иметь возможность эффективно избегать N + 1 и декартовых объединений, объединяющих вместе четырехуровневую сущность с ...
вопрос задан: 7 February 2012 01:02
0
ответов

Решение запросов Django N + 1

Я посетил http://guides.rubyonrails.org/active_record_querying.html после разговора с одноранговый узел в отношении N + 1 и серьезных последствий для производительности плохих запросов к БД. ActiveRecord (Rails): clients = ...
вопрос задан: 5 January 2012 11:31
0
ответов

Hibernate Suplect VS Patch Petching

Hibernate обеспечивает (по крайней мере) два варианта для охвата от N + 1 проблема. The One устанавливает FetchMode для подсероуказа, что генерирует выбор с предложением в разделе и подселек в этом ...
вопрос задан: 30 August 2011 06:49